CHOCOLATE-FROSTED MINT BARS



Chocolate-Frosted Mint Bars image

Love the combo of chocolate and mint? Here's a bar you'll want to try again and again.

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 2h

Yield 36

Number Of Ingredients 17

1 package (8 oz) c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up granulated sugar
1 egg
1 teaspoon mint extract
4 drops green food color
1 cup butter or margarine
4 oz unsweetened baking chocolate, cut into pieces
2 cups granulated s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la
4 eggs
1 cup Gold Medal™ all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ons butter or margarine
2 tablespoons corn syrup
2 tablespoons water
2 oz unsweetened baking chocolate, cut into pieces
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 cup powdered sugar

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350°F. Grease bottom and sides of 13x9-inch pan with shortening; lightly flour. In small bowl, beat cream cheese and 1/4 cup sugar with spoon until smooth. Stir in 1 egg, the mint extract and food color until well mixed; set aside.
  • In 3-quart saucepan, melt 1 cup butter and 4 oz chocolate over very low heat, stirring constantly; remove from heat. Cool 15 minutes or until slightly cooled.
  • Stir 2 cups sugar and 2 teaspoons vanilla into chocolate mixture. Add 4 eggs, one at a time, beating well with spoon after each addition. Stir in flour. Spread in pan. Carefully spoon cream cheese mixture over brownie mixture. Lightly swirl cream cheese mixture into brownie mixture with knife for marbled design.
  • Bake 45 to 50 minutes or until set. Cool 30 minutes at room temperature. Refrigerate 1 hour.
  • Meanwhile, in 2-quart saucepan, heat 2 tablespoons butter, the corn syrup and water to rolling boil, stirring frequently; remove from heat. Stir in 2 oz chocolate until melted. Stir in 1 teaspoon vanilla and the powdered sugar. Beat with spoon until smooth. Frost chilled bars with Chocolate Frosting. For bars, cut into 6 rows by 6 rows. Store covered in refrigerator.

CHOCOLATE MINT BARS



Chocolate Mint Bars image

Don't be afraid of the ingredient list. These bars are really easy, super yummy and perfect for the Holidays.

Provided by Jodid

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h15m

Yield 18-24 bars

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 cup sugar
1/2 cup margarine, softened
4 eggs, beaten
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 cup flour
1 (16 ounce) can hershey chocolate syrup
2 cups powdered sugar
1/2 cup margarine, softened
1 tablespoon milk
2 teaspoons peppermint extract
green food coloring
1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
6 tablespoons margarine

Steps:

  • Mix sugar through chocolate syrup for bars and put into a greased 9x13" pan.
  • Bake at 350 degrees for 30 minutes.
  • (Don't use a glass pan).
  • Cool.
  • Mix Filling ingredients (powdered sugar through green food coloring) and spread over cooled bars.
  • Melt chocolate chips and 6 Tbsp margarine over stove top and smooth over the filling.
  • Chill until firm.

FROSTED MINT CHOCOLATE BARS ~ NO BAKE, VEGAN



Frosted Mint Chocolate Bars ~ No Bake, Vegan image

Provided by Kelly

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 11

For the Base:
1 + ½ cups walnut pieces
¾ to 1 cup pitted dates
⅓ cup smooth almond butter
For the Mint Chocolate Topping:
100 grams (roughly 1 cup) 75% cocoa chocolate, chopped
1 ripe banana
1 tsp pure mint extract or to taste (it's quite present so go easy at first and increase as desired)
2 tsp vanilla extract
2 Tbsp honey or pure maple syrup
2 Tbsp unsweetened desiccated coconut for topping

Steps:

  • While you are assembling your materials, submerge dates in hot water to soften them for a few minutes before draining (I boil water in the kettle and pour it over the dates set in a bowl).
  • Place chocolate in a small sturdy pot on the stove over lowest heat. Allow chocolate to melt, stirring to assist. As soon as chocolate has melted, remove from heat and set aside.
  • In a food processor or blender, combine walnuts, softened dates and almond butter. Process until well combined (you will still see some small nut pieces).
  • It's important that the base mixture be sticky. If it's too dry, you can add a little bit more almond butter or coconut milk to achieve desired consistency. If the mixture is too wet (looks like a big ball in the blender rather than distributed), add a few more nuts. Scoop base mixture out of food processor/blender and place in a parchment lined loaf pan.
  • Using the back of a spoon or cake knife, spread the base mixture evenly in the pan while patting it down with your hands (it should end up being about a half inch thick).
  • Using the same blender or food processor, add melted chocolate, banana, mint extract, vanilla extract and honey or maple syrup. Blend until smooth and silky (it's a thing of beauty!).
  • Pour mint chocolate topping over the base and spread evenly using a spoon or knife to assist. Sprinkle chocolate layer with a dusting of coconut.
  • Place loaf pan in the fridge for 1 hour (or the freezer for 20 minutes or so) until the topping has solidified over the base.
  • Remove from fridge/freezer and cut into bars or squares, as desired.
  • You can store the bars/squares in the freezer or fridge as desired. They travel well.

FUDGY MINT SQUARES



Fudgy Mint Squares image

I've had this recipe since I was in junior high school. No one can resist the fudgy brownie base, cool minty cheesecake filling and luscious chocolate glaze in these mouthwatering bars.-Heather Campbell, Lawrence, Kansas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ield about 4 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 13

10 tablespoons butter, divided
3 ounces unsweetened chocolate, chopped
3 large eggs
1-1/2 cups s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, softened
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1 can (14 ounces) sweetened condensed milk
1 teaspoon peppermint extract
4 drops green food coloring, optional
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ips
1/2 cup heavy whipping cream

Steps:

  • In a microwave, melt 8 tablespoons butter and unsweetened chocolate; stir until smooth. Cool slightly. In a small bowl, beat 2 eggs, sugar and vanilla. Beat in chocolate mixture until blended. Gradually stir in flour. , Spread into a greased 13-in. x 9-in. baking pan. Bake at 350° for 15-20 minutes or until top is set. , In a large bowl, beat cream cheese and remaining butter until fluffy. Add cornstarch; beat until smooth. Gradually beat in milk and remaining egg. Beat in extract and food coloring if desired. , Pour over crust. Bake for 15-20 minutes or until center is almost set. Cool on a wire rack., In a small heavy saucepan, combine chocolate chips and cream. Cook and stir over medium heat until chips are melted. Cool for 30 minutes or until lukewarm, stirring occasionally. Pour over cream cheese layer. Chill for 2 hours or until set before cutting.
